About This Item

N Y: W.W. Norton, 1988. Oversize Hardback. Near Fine/Very Good. XL. A clean, unmarked book with a tight binding. 8 3/4""w x 12 1/4""h. 144 pages. Many illustrations and detailed instructions for cutting, sewing, seaming, stitching, patching and splicing, including roep-to-wire splicing, knot tying, designing, and machine and hand stitching. In addition, the author tells where to find and how to use the proper tools and materials for making all those separate items that make up a boat's rigging, sails, and equipment.
